Promote children's phones with mobile companies, restricting internet access and app downloads

Recommendation
The next Government should work with mobile phone companies and network operators to promote children’s phones, a class of phone which can be used for contact and GPS location but not access to the internet or downloading apps.
Government Response Summary
The government acknowledges the market is considering 'children's phones' and is monitoring developments, but states its current focus is on the effective implementation of the Online Safety Act to ensure children's online safety regardless of device.

Government is aware that the market is considering devices such as this, where there is market demand for phones with various functionalities. government is monitoring the development of such phones but is currently focused on the effective implementation of the Online Safety Act so children can have a safer online experience regardless of the device they’re using. We acknowledge the importance of technology creators ensuring that their products are safe and not exploiting vulnerabilities. The Online Safety Act will introduce safeguards that protect children from illegal content or activity and protect children from accessing harmful and age-inappropriate content. We are focused on getting these protections implemented swiftly and effectively.
